Company A acquires Company B. Company A has larger revenue than Company B, but Company B has higher profits than Company A. Given they have similar fixed costs, how is Company B more profitable than Company A? How might Company A improve their profit margins?

Behavioral: Tell me about yourself. A time you had to think outside the box? A time you thought a problem was hard but had a simple fix? UX Case: (Product and Search Page of AAA batteries) What are some improvements we can make to these pages? How can we stop a downward spiral of prices? (If Jet lowers its price, then a competitor lowers its price in response to our price, etc. how do we stop that?) Rapid fire round (2nd half of UX): Favorite person? Least favorite person? How do you like your coffee? How would your friends describe you? Price Case Study: Men's shoulder bag is sold on Amazon for $10 and in Walmart stores for $5. How should we price this on Walmart.com? Same product. Same company costs. The goal is to "make money".
